Diesel, kerosene prices drop; gasoline rises on April 28

Oil firms will implement fuel price adjustments on Tuesday, April 28, 2026, with diesel and kerosene posting rollbacks while gasoline edges higher. The Department of Energy reported a minimum diesel rollback of P12.94 per liter, kerosene by P15.71 per liter, and a gasoline increase of P0.53 per liter.

MANILA, Philippines — Oil firms will implement price adjustments effective 6 a.m. on Tuesday, April 28, 2026. This marks the third consecutive week of changes following rollbacks that began on April 14, after sustained increases since late February driven by Middle East tensions.

The Department of Energy said the minimum rollback for diesel is P12.94 per liter, while kerosene will decrease by P15.71 per liter. Gasoline prices are set to increase by P0.53 per liter.

Companies including UniOil, Shell, and SeaOil announced: gasoline +P0.53/L, diesel -P12.94/L, and kerosene -P15.71/L for Shell. Estimates are based on DOE NCR prevailing retail prices for April 21-27, 2026.

These shifts come as Middle East conflicts have persisted since March, according to reports.
